The power antenna on my 1980 300TD is stuck. I can hear the motor working, but antenna will only go up about 1/3 of the way. I tried lubing up the antenna without success. If I give the antenna a good tug while the motor is turning, it will go on up to full extension. It just feels like it is sticking. Do I need to replace the whole unit? If so, how difficult is the job? Thanks much!

You can replace just the mast. There is two slots on the bottom. You can order one from us in the partsshop.

I had the same problem and it was definitely the mast. A very easy fix. The M-B replacement mast even had instructions printed right on the bag. Antenna now works like brand new.
